Output 86d529e4e1e64c2079ae18dce4bf65c35ce19e2dc1ad7760f60c645788c2f938:5

value
76784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1218933993897c59fd06165b70e999e64fa8c429 OP_EQUAL
address
33LhXWD3NmBXLGLTWPYbSkmxhMtPKA7cvT
transaction
86d529e4e1e64c2079ae18dce4bf65c35ce19e2dc1ad7760f60c645788c2f938
spent
true